The setting of the story was very surprising, as it takes place in a city built underground. The “serene community inhabited by some of the most important people in the world. But this tranquility explodes when a shocking murder occurs and a high -post -content survey takes place.”
The series comes from Dan Fogelman e Sterling K. Brown (this is us) stars as secret service agent Xavier Collins. Also the stars James Marsden, Julianne Nicholson, Sarah Shahi, Nicole Brydon Bloom, Aliyah Mastin AND Percy daggs iv.
Well, the series has been renewed for a second season and I can’t wait to see how history continues to take place. I guess there is still a long story to tell.
